Would I be committing an offence if I poisoned the tree? A: You cannot poison your neighbour's tree. If you do then you could be committing the offence of criminal damage and find yourself facing court charges and a fine. If you have a neighbours tree hanging over your land, you can: exercise the common law right of abatementyour right to remove overhanging branches and roots to your boundary line decide whether to return the lopped branches, roots or fruit to your neighbour, or dispose of them yourself.
